French Louis XVI Low Caned Fireside Slipper Chair, 18th Century
Located in Montreal, Quebec
French Louis XVI low caned fireside slipper chair, 18th century.
This very rare and exceptional low chair is very old, and has withstood the test of time in a remarkably good state, with a minor loss to the base of the caning in a lower corner of the back (see picture). The caning has a lovely pattern. This low, deep chair was probably a fireside chair. However small metal bolts in the back suggest that it may have at some point been attached, possibly to a vehicle or to some kind of carrying device.
It is beautiful and highly decorative. Though it is quite comfortable, we do not recommend it be used for seating to protect the antique caned seat...

Rustic French 1890s Cherry Wood Armchair with Rush Seat and Sheaf Back
Located in Atlanta, GA
A rustic French cherry wood armchair from the late 19th century, with rush seat and sheaf back. Created in France during the last decade of the 19th century, this cherry wood armchair charms us with its rustic appeal and turned accents. The chair showcases a sheaf back with turned supports, connected to two open curving arms. The rush seat (measuring 19"D x 14"H) is resting on four turned legs connected to one another through an apron carved with petite motifs in the front, as well as an H-form cross stretcher.
